Trail Overview

Starting in the small village of Ejido Plan Nacional Agrario, this trail offers a mellow, scenic desert drive that highlights the quiet beauty of northern Baja. The trail winds through classic sandy terrain, dotted with tall Ocotillos and dense Creosote--giving off that iconic desert vibe from the moment you set out. The surface is mostly hard-packed sand, with the occasional washboard section adding a bit of texture to the ride. No 4WD is required, but a high-clearance vehicle is recommended for navigating a few uneven patches along the way. The trail loops around a massive rock hill that dominates the landscape, serving as a striking landmark and natural waypoint. As you climb slightly in elevation, the views open up to reveal the jagged Sierra San Felipe in the distance and the shimmering blue of the Sea of Cortez along the horizon--a perfect backdrop for a relaxed desert cruise.

Difficulty

This is a mostly easy, high-clearance 2WD trail. The road is smooth, scenic, and beginner-friendly, with a few light bumps along the way.
